Perceptions of exclusive breastfeeding among Bidayuh mothers in Sarawak, Malaysia: a qualitative study
Despite its benefits, exclusive breast feeding is not widely practised in Malaysia. As the decision for exclusive breastfeeding is influenced by social and cultural context, it is important to conduct studies in different societies in Malaysia. This qualitative study aimed to explore the perceptions...
